1f193f798SVadim PasternakWhat:		/sys/devices/platform/mlxplat/mlxreg-io/hwmon/hwmon*/
2f193f798SVadim Pasternak							asic_health
3f193f798SVadim Pasternak
4f193f798SVadim PasternakDate:		June 2018
5f193f798SVadim PasternakKernelVersion:	4.19
6f193f798SVadim PasternakContact:	Vadim Pasternak <vadimpmellanox.com>
7f193f798SVadim PasternakDescription:	This file shows ASIC health status. The possible values are:
8f193f798SVadim Pasternak		0 - health failed, 2 - health OK, 3 - ASIC in booting state.
9f193f798SVadim Pasternak
10f193f798SVadim Pasternak		The files are read only.
11f193f798SVadim Pasternak
12f193f798SVadim PasternakWhat:		/sys/devices/platform/mlxplat/mlxreg-io/hwmon/hwmon*/
13f193f798SVadim Pasternak							cpld1_version
14f193f798SVadim Pasternak							cpld2_version
15f193f798SVadim PasternakDate:		June 2018
16f193f798SVadim PasternakKernelVersion:	4.19
17f193f798SVadim PasternakContact:	Vadim Pasternak <vadimpmellanox.com>
18f193f798SVadim PasternakDescription:	These files show with which CPLD versions have been burned
19f193f798SVadim Pasternak		on carrier and switch boards.
20f193f798SVadim Pasternak
21f193f798SVadim Pasternak		The files are read only.
22f193f798SVadim Pasternak
2352675da1SVadim PasternakWhat:		/sys/devices/platform/mlxplat/mlxreg-io/hwmon/hwmon*/
2452675da1SVadim Pasternak							cpld3_version
2552675da1SVadim Pasternak
2652675da1SVadim PasternakDate:		November 2018
2752675da1SVadim PasternakKernelVersion:	4.21
2852675da1SVadim PasternakContact:	Vadim Pasternak <vadimpmellanox.com>
2952675da1SVadim PasternakDescription:	These files show with which CPLD versions have been burned
3052675da1SVadim Pasternak		on LED board.
3152675da1SVadim Pasternak
3252675da1SVadim Pasternak		The files are read only.
3352675da1SVadim Pasternak
3452675da1SVadim PasternakWhat:		/sys/devices/platform/mlxplat/mlxreg-io/hwmon/hwmon*/
3552675da1SVadim Pasternak							jtag_enable
3652675da1SVadim Pasternak
3752675da1SVadim PasternakDate:		November 2018
3852675da1SVadim PasternakKernelVersion:	4.21
3952675da1SVadim PasternakContact:	Vadim Pasternak <vadimpmellanox.com>
4052675da1SVadim PasternakDescription:	These files enable and disable the access to the JTAG domain.
4152675da1SVadim Pasternak		By default access to the JTAG domain is disabled.
4252675da1SVadim Pasternak
4352675da1SVadim Pasternak		The file is read/write.
4452675da1SVadim Pasternak
45f193f798SVadim PasternakWhat:		/sys/devices/platform/mlxplat/mlxreg-io/hwmon/hwmon*/select_iio
46f193f798SVadim PasternakDate:		June 2018
47f193f798SVadim PasternakKernelVersion:	4.19
48f193f798SVadim PasternakContact:	Vadim Pasternak <vadimpmellanox.com>
49f193f798SVadim PasternakDescription:	This file allows iio devices selection.
50f193f798SVadim Pasternak
51f193f798SVadim Pasternak		Attribute select_iio can be written with 0 or with 1. It
52f193f798SVadim Pasternak		selects which one of iio devices can be accessed.
53f193f798SVadim Pasternak
54f193f798SVadim Pasternak		The file is read/write.
55f193f798SVadim Pasternak
56f193f798SVadim PasternakWhat:		/sys/devices/platform/mlxplat/mlxreg-io/hwmon/hwmon*/psu1_on
57f193f798SVadim Pasternak		/sys/devices/platform/mlxplat/mlxreg-io/hwmon/hwmon*/psu2_on
58f193f798SVadim Pasternak		/sys/devices/platform/mlxplat/mlxreg-io/hwmon/hwmon*/pwr_cycle
59f193f798SVadim Pasternak		/sys/devices/platform/mlxplat/mlxreg-io/hwmon/hwmon*/pwr_down
60f193f798SVadim PasternakDate:		June 2018
61f193f798SVadim PasternakKernelVersion:	4.19
62f193f798SVadim PasternakContact:	Vadim Pasternak <vadimpmellanox.com>
63f193f798SVadim PasternakDescription:	These files allow asserting system power cycling, switching
64f193f798SVadim Pasternak		power supply units on and off and system's main power domain
65f193f798SVadim Pasternak		shutdown.
66f193f798SVadim Pasternak		Expected behavior:
67f193f798SVadim Pasternak		When pwr_cycle is written 1: auxiliary power domain will go
68f193f798SVadim Pasternak		down and after short period (about 1 second) up.
69f193f798SVadim Pasternak		When  psu1_on or psu2_on is written 1, related unit will be
70f193f798SVadim Pasternak		disconnected from the power source, when written 0 - connected.
71f193f798SVadim Pasternak		If both are written 1 - power supplies main power domain will
72f193f798SVadim Pasternak		go down.
73f193f798SVadim Pasternak		When pwr_down is written 1, system's main power domain will go
74f193f798SVadim Pasternak		down.
75f193f798SVadim Pasternak
76f193f798SVadim Pasternak		The files are write only.
77f193f798SVadim Pasternak
78f193f798SVadim PasternakWhat:		/sys/devices/platform/mlxplat/mlxreg-io/hwmon/hwmon*/
79f193f798SVadim Pasternak							reset_aux_pwr_or_ref
80f193f798SVadim Pasternak							reset_asic_thermal
81a34e1343SVadim Pasternak							reset_hotswap_or_halt
82f193f798SVadim Pasternak							reset_hotswap_or_wd
83f193f798SVadim Pasternak							reset_fw_reset
84f193f798SVadim Pasternak							reset_long_pb
85f193f798SVadim Pasternak							reset_main_pwr_fail
86f193f798SVadim Pasternak							reset_short_pb
87f193f798SVadim Pasternak							reset_sw_reset
88f193f798SVadim PasternakDate:		June 2018
89f193f798SVadim PasternakKernelVersion:	4.19
90f193f798SVadim PasternakContact:	Vadim Pasternak <vadimpmellanox.com>
91f193f798SVadim PasternakDescription:	These files show the system reset cause, as following: power
92a34e1343SVadim Pasternak		auxiliary outage or power refresh, ASIC thermal shutdown, halt,
93a34e1343SVadim Pasternak		hotswap, watchdog, firmware reset, long press power button,
94f193f798SVadim Pasternak		short press power button, software reset. Value 1 in file means
95f193f798SVadim Pasternak		this is reset cause, 0 - otherwise. Only one of the above
96f193f798SVadim Pasternak		causes could be 1 at the same time, representing only last
97f193f798SVadim Pasternak		reset cause.
98f193f798SVadim Pasternak
99f193f798SVadim Pasternak		The files are read only.
10052675da1SVadim Pasternak
10152675da1SVadim PasternakWhat:		/sys/devices/platform/mlxplat/mlxreg-io/hwmon/hwmon*/
10252675da1SVadim Pasternak						reset_comex_pwr_fail
10352675da1SVadim Pasternak						reset_from_comex
10452675da1SVadim Pasternak						reset_system
10552675da1SVadim Pasternak						reset_voltmon_upgrade_fail
10652675da1SVadim Pasternak
10752675da1SVadim PasternakDate:		November 2018
10852675da1SVadim PasternakKernelVersion:	4.21
10952675da1SVadim PasternakContact:	Vadim Pasternak <vadimpmellanox.com>
11052675da1SVadim PasternakDescription:	These files show the system reset cause, as following: ComEx
11152675da1SVadim Pasternak		power fail, reset from ComEx, system platform reset, reset
11252675da1SVadim Pasternak		due to voltage monitor devices upgrade failure,
11352675da1SVadim Pasternak		Value 1 in file means this is reset cause, 0 - otherwise.
11452675da1SVadim Pasternak		Only one bit could be 1 at the same time, representing only
11552675da1SVadim Pasternak		the last reset cause.
11652675da1SVadim Pasternak
11752675da1SVadim Pasternak		The files are read only.
118